These are institutions that they have to navigate like mice working their way through a maze. Each hour waiting in the hospital, or the courthouse, or the intake center, is an hour that numbs them. An hour of forms to be filled and absurd rules to be followed. Sometimes they really are mice in a maze. Sometimes scientists study them, put them in a lab, give them crack, and attach them to monitors, poking and prodding them. Takeesha did that once. “One time I did this crack study for $2,500. It was psychological. I saw the advertisement on the train and went to this building on the university. ...more
